Blast hits Bonifacio Global City | Inquirer News
MANILA, Philippines – Fear gripped the Bonifacio Global City in Taguig Wednesday after an explosion rocked the highly urbanized district, radio reports said.
No one was reported injured in the blast that occurred outside the Parkade 2 building at the corner of 7th Avenue and 30th Street.
The cause of the explosion was unclear.
But reports said people in the area told authorities that a strong stench of liquefied petroleum gas was in the air when the explosion happened.
Witnesses also said that manhole covers flung up with columns of fire, indicating that the blast occurred underground.
